Hi,
in my work I have a lot of formulas inkl. subformulas. Doing the examples at
the wiki two questions came up:
a) how to generate a table of formulas?
b) what is the right/better way for subnumbering?
a) I tried the example for generating a table of formulas from the wiki
(http://wiki.contextgarden.net/Math/Display#List_of_Formulas) but instead of
a list I get in the pdf a »no list method«. What do I missed here?
b) I found two descriped ways how to create formula (sub-)numbering:
1) using \formulanumber and \subformulanumber (third example from
http://wiki.contextgarden.net/Math/Display#The_Manual_Method). But context
always reports here: ! Undefined control sequence.
<argument> ...^{\vfrac {1}{2}} &\subformulanumber
{b}\cr a^2 + b^2 &= c^2
&\...
2) using the \NR[..] like it is described on
http://wiki.contextgarden.net/Multiline_equations#Working_with_equation_numbering
and http://dl.contextgarden.net/myway/mathalign.pdf. This way compiles
through.
But which way is the future context way? In which way can I combine
subnumbering and including to list some (not all) subformulas?
Thanks for your help

Did you found anything?
I tried to figure out which command in the examples of the wiki work/dont
work (I used mkiv stable). So far:
\formulanumber -> works in mkii and mkiv
\subformulanumber -> works only in mkii
\placenamedsubformula -> works only in mkii
\placesubformula & \NR[+] -> mkii & mkiv, but (1.name) as number
\placeformula & \NR[+] -> works in mkii and mkiv, but (1.name) as number
I have a real problem to transform my formula from mkii to mkiv. In mkii I
had following:
\placesubformulawithnumber[gleichung1]
\startformula
\startalign[n=3, align={right,middle,left}]
\NC PM \xrightarrow{aaa} \NC R_{PM} \NC \xrightarrow{bbb} PM
\NR[gleichung1a][.1]
\NC R_{PM} \NC = \NC \{ K, F \} \NR[gleichung1b][.2]
\stopalign
\stopformula
Can anyone help me to transform this to mkiv, please?

done.. you can find the test file for formulas with mkiv attached to this
email.
I ran it with the latest beta. A couple of things are working.. but e.g.
most ways for subformulas not.
The listing is half working.. only the formulas names are missing and the
order with the only example with working subformulas is strange.
If I made any mkiv mistake please excuse... I tried to figure out / guessed
the right mkiv ways.
I hope this test files helps you to identify the problem areas.
---------8<-------------------
\starttext
\title{List of formulas}
Strange: Missing name of first formula and strange order of .. 2.a, 2,
2.b...
\placelist[formula][criterium=all,alternative=c]
\subject{math - formula}
This works fine.
\placenamedformula[one]{Der einfache Test}
\startformula
c^2 = a^2 + b^2.
\stopformula
\subject{math - subformula}
This works fine.
\startsubformulas[eq:1]
\placeformula[eq:first]
\startformula
PM \xrightarrow R_{PM} \xrightarrow PM
\stopformula
\placeformula[eq:second]
\startformula
R_{PM} = \{ K, F, Z, U, I, J\}
\stopformula
\stopsubformulas
\subject{math - align - formula}
Works.
\placeformula
\startformula
\startalign[n=3, align={right,middle,left}]
\NC PM \xrightarrow \NC R_{PM} \NC \xrightarrow PM \NR[gleichung1a]
\NC R_{PM} \NC = \NC \{ A, B, C, D, E\} \NR[gleichung1b]
\stopalign
\stopformula
Also works.
\placeformula
\startformula
\startalign[n=3, align={right,middle,left}]
\NC PM \xrightarrow \NC R_{PM} \NC \xrightarrow PM \NR[+]
\NC R_{PM} \NC = \NC \{ A, B, C, D, E\} \NR[+]
\stopalign
\stopformula
\subject{math - align - subformula}
Does not work: no subformula numbers
\placesubformula
\startformula
\startalign[n=3, align={right,middle,left}]
\NC PM \xrightarrow \NC R_{PM} \NC \xrightarrow PM \NR[gleichung1a][.1]
\NC R_{PM} \NC = \NC \{ A, B, C, D, E\} \NR[gleichung1b][.2]
\stopalign
\stopformula
Does not work: no subformula numbers
\placesubformula
\startformula
\startalign[n=3, align={right,middle,left}]
\NC PM \xrightarrow \NC R_{PM} \NC \xrightarrow PM \NR[gleichung1a][+]
\NC R_{PM} \NC = \NC \{ A, B, C, D, E\} \NR[gleichung1b][+]
\stopalign
\stopformula
\subject{math - eqalignno - formula}
Taken from wiki and removed the subformulanumber
\placeformula
\startformula
\eqalignno{
c^2 &= a^2 + b^2 &\formulanumber \cr
c &= \left(a^2 + b^2\right)^{\vfrac{1}{2}} &\formulanumber\cr
a^2 + b^2 &= c^2 &\formulanumber \cr
d^2 &= e^2 &\formulanumber \cr}
\stopformula
\subject{math - eqalignno - subformula}
Directly taken form wiki - does not work: subformulanumber is unknown.
%\placeformula
%\startformula
%\eqalignno{
% c^2 &= a^2 + b^2 &\formulanumber{a} \cr
% c &= \left(a^2 + b^2\right)^{\vfrac{1}{2}} &\subformulanumber{b}\cr
% a^2 + b^2 &= c^2 &\subformulanumber{c} \cr
% d^2 &= e^2 &\formulanumber\cr}
%\stopformula
\stoptext
